Transaction 664d240b739de979a4be1342e2b35fc5dd540e3e464f9a18c8859e1f1e25a2ea
1 Input
1 Output
-
664d240b739de979a4be1342e2b35fc5dd540e3e464f9a18c8859e1f1e25a2ea:0
- value
- 1408661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e58cd5afc8a00fdd924aadf11f78178cadb2de88 OP_EQUAL
- address
- 3NcmNqhEVaQJ5fx5XdT4Ck6QyejWr1C9dY